Pecan Chocolate Chip Pie

SUBMITTED BY: Carolyn

"To please the chocolate lover and the pecan lover. This pie is great topped with whipped cream and chocolate chips."
Original recipe yield 1 pie

INGREDIENTS (Nutrition)

  • 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/8 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up butter, chilled and diced
  • 5 tablespoons ice water
  • 3 eggs
  • 3/4 cup white sugar
  • 3/4 cup light corn syrup
  • 1/4 cup butter, melted
  • 1/2 cup semisweet chocolate chips
  • 1/2 cup chopped pecans

DIRECTIONS

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  2. To Make Crust: In a medium bowl combine flour and salt. Stir well, then cut in butter until mixture is the size of small peas. Add ice water and mix just until dough forms a ball.
  3. Allow dough to rest in refrigerator for 20 minutes, then roll out and fit into a 9-inch pie plate. Set aside.
  4. To Make Filling: In a medium bowl mix eggs and sugar. Add corn syrup and melted butter or margarine. Mix until all ingredients are thoroughly combined.
  5. Spread chocolate chips and pecan pieces across bottom of pie shell. Pour egg mixture over chocolate chip and pecan layer.
  6. Bake in preheated oven for 35 minutes. Serve warm or cool with a dollop of whipped cream and a sprinkling of chocolate chips if desired.
